repo.or.cz
/
ozulis.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[mugiwara] using @ and $ to say it's a pointer or get the address, and to unreference...
2009-03-18
Alexandre Bique
[m
u
g
iwar
a
] usin
g
@ and $ to
s
ay it's
a pointer or ge
t
.
.
.
commit
|
commitdiff
|
tree
2009-03-16
A
l
exandre
Bique
local
v
ariabl
e
wa
s
n
ot typed as refere
n
ce
d
type
commit
|
commitdiff
|
tree
2009-03-15
Alexandre Bi
q
u
e
t
h
e
com
p
ilers initialize
i
t
s target data with
n
ative
.
.
.
commit
|
commitdiff
|
tree
2009-03-15
Alexandre
B
ique
Added
ta
r
g
et data
commit
|
commitdiff
|
tree
2009-03-15
Alexandre Bique
came back to the
s
tab
l
e stade where i don't use ll
v
m
.
.
.
commit
|
commitdiff
|
tree
2009-03-15
Al
e
xandre Bique
The compi
l
er is
n
ow
a Si
n
gleton
commit
|
commitdiff
|
tree
2009-03-15
Alexa
n
dre
B
ique
Factorized s
o
me
code and renamed LLVM
G
eneratorVisitor
.
.
.
commit
|
commitdiff
|
tree
2009-03-15
Alexa
n
dre
Bique
Removed trai
l
ling whit
e
spa
c
es
commit
|
commitdiff
|
tree
2009-03-15
Alexand
r
e Bique
U
s
ing C
+
+ sizeof to deter
m
ine th
e
si
z
e of the t
y
p
e
s
.
commit
|
commitdiff
|
tree
2009-03-15
A
l
exand
r
e Bique
Renamed check_e
x
pr
.
sh to
check-expr
.
sh for namin
g
consistency
commit
|
commitdiff
|
tree
2009-03-15
Ale
x
andre
B
ique
buil
d
ing more compl
e
te tags file for
vim
commit
|
commitdiff
|
tree
2009-03-15
Alex
a
nd
r
e
B
ique
Added support for strings in the language mugiwara
commit
|
commitdiff
|
tree
2009-03-14
Al
e
xandre Biqu
e
can call
ext
e
rnal fun
c
tions
commit
|
commitdiff
|
tree
2009-03-14
Alexandre Bique
sim
p
lif
i
ed D
e
refenceByIndex w
i
th
typechecker's p
o
inter
.
.
.
commit
|
commitdiff
|
tree
2009-03-14
Alexandre Bi
q
ue
a
d
ded
sup
p
ort f
o
r p
o
inter a
r
ithmetic
:
-)
commit
|
commitdiff
|
tree
2009-03-14
Alexandre Bique
tryin
g
t
o
out
p
ut nicer asm
commit
|
commitdiff
|
tree
2009-03-14
Alex
a
ndre
B
ique
fi
x
ed path
f
o
r c
h
eck_expr
.
sh
commit
|
commitdiff
|
tree
2009-03-14
Alex
a
ndre Bique
u
s
e
poin
t
ers like this: a[4] works
:
-)
commit
|
commitdiff
|
tree
2009-03-14
Al
e
xandre Bique
cl
e
a
n
ed some code
commit
|
commitdiff
|
tree
2009-03-14
Alexandre Bique
some
w
or
k
o
n
arrays
commit
|
commitdiff
|
tree
2009-03-13
Alexandre Bique
sta
r
ting the a
r
ray
access a[x]
commit
|
commitdiff
|
tree
2009-03-13
Alexandre Bique
[pointers
]
f
inish
e
d :-)
commit
|
commitdiff
|
tree
2009-03-13
Alexan
d
re Bique
[pointe
r
s] need to
u
nref typ
e
s
commit
|
commitdiff
|
tree
2009-03-13
Alexandre Bi
q
ue
[po
i
nters] some
work on dereferenc
e
men
t
commit
|
commitdiff
|
tree
2009-03-12
Alex
a
n
d
re Bique
some re
a
rangement here
:
-)
commit
|
commitdiff
|
tree
2009-03-12
Alex
a
ndre Bique
cle
a
n
e
d roadmap
commit
|
commitdiff
|
tree
2009-03-12
A
l
exandre Bique
f
i
b
o
n
a
c
c
i w
o
rks again
commit
|
commitdiff
|
tree
2009-03-12
Alexandre Bique
e
verything is broken, but this is the good way ;-)
commit
|
commitdiff
|
tree
2009-03-12
A
lexa
n
d
r
e Biqu
e
more r
e
addab
l
e doxygen
commit
|
commitdiff
|
tree
2009-03-11
Al
e
x
a
ndre Bique
i
should
u
nreference some
types
commit
|
commitdiff
|
tree
2009-03-11
Alexandre
B
ique
fixed a bug with
CmpExp
commit
|
commitdiff
|
tree
2009-03-11
A
l
exandre Bique
i
t's workin
g
a
g
a
i
n
:)
commit
|
commitdiff
|
tree
2009-03-11
Alexandre Biqu
e
i know
t
his b
r
eaks eve
r
ything :-)
commit
|
commitdiff
|
tree
2009-03-11
Al
e
xa
n
dre Bique
fi
x
e
d
the type of comp
a
rai
s
ons
commit
|
commitdiff
|
tree
2009-03-11
Alexandre Bi
q
ue
more use
f
ull typedef
s
int
a
s
t
/ast
.
hh
commit
|
commitdiff
|
tree
2009-03-11
Ale
x
andre Bique
basic function cal
l
ing
commit
|
commitdiff
|
tree
2009-03-11
Alexandre
Bique
[llvm g
e
ner
a
tor] correctly
generate function's prot
o
type
commit
|
commitdiff
|
tree
2009-03-11
A
l
exa
n
dre Bique
w
o
rked on CallExp type ch
e
cking
commit
|
commitdiff
|
tree
2009-03-11
Ale
x
a
n
dre Bique
f
i
xed isSigned
while parsing numbe
r
s
commit
|
commitdiff
|
tree
2009-03-11
Al
e
x
andre Bique
started type
che
c
kin
g
o
n
calle
x
p
commit
|
commitdiff
|
tree
2009-03-11
Alexa
n
d
r
e Bique
Added headers
t
o
c
m
ake
commit
|
commitdiff
|
tree
2009-03-11
Ale
x
and
r
e Bique
added details to
the ro
a
dmap
commit
|
commitdiff
|
tree
2009-03-11
Alexandre Bi
q
ue
begun som
e
work
on
f
u
nct
i
o
n
c
all
commit
|
commitdiff
|
tree
2009-03-11
A
l
exandre Biqu
e
added some fun
c
t
ion t
e
st
s
commit
|
commitdiff
|
tree
2009-03-10
A
lexan
d
re Bique
s
o
m
e
work
a
bou
t
retu
r
n void;
commit
|
commitdiff
|
tree
2009-03-10
Al
e
xandre
B
ique
su
p
pressed so
m
e warnin
g
s
commit
|
commitdiff
|
tree
2009-03-10
Alexandre Bique
a
d
ded missing tests
commit
|
commitdiff
|
tree
2009-03-10
Ale
x
andre Bique
updated exp
r
tests
commit
|
commitdiff
|
tree
2009-03-09
Alexandre
Bique
implem
e
nted return statem
e
nt, an
d
if/while/dowhile
.
.
.
commit
|
commitdiff
|
tree
2009-03-09
Alexandre B
i
que
added a ro
a
dm
a
p
commit
|
commitdiff
|
tree
2009-03-09
Alexandre Bique
imple
m
ented
r
eturn, but not
t
este
d
commit
|
commitdiff
|
tree
2009-03-06
A
l
exandre B
i
q
u
e
b
egun s
o
me work on return statemen
t
commit
|
commitdiff
|
tree
2009-03-05
Alexandre Bique
factorised loop
c
ode
commit
|
commitdiff
|
tree
2009-03-05
Alexandre
Bique
add
e
d
s
u
ppo
r
t
for w
h
i
le
l
o
ops, i shou
l
d
facto
r
ize cmp
.
.
.
commit
|
commitdiff
|
tree
2009-03-05
Al
e
xandre Bique
added do whi
l
e
commit
|
commitdiff
|
tree
2009-03-05
Alexandre Bique
a
d
d
ed p
a
tch to bison'
s
g
lr
.
c
commit
|
commitdiff
|
tree
2009-03-05
Alexandre Bique
fixed
n
eg expr
f
or floating po
i
nt typ
e
commit
|
commitdiff
|
tree
2009-03-05
Alexand
r
e Biqu
e
implement
e
d
u
n
ary exp i
n
simplify visitor
commit
|
commitdiff
|
tree
2009-03-05
A
l
e
x
andre
Biqu
e
impl
e
mented unary exp in llvm gene
r
a
t
o
r
commit
|
commitdiff
|
tree
2009-03-05
Ale
x
andre Bi
q
ue
typecheck unary exp
commit
|
commitdiff
|
tree
2009-03-05
Alexa
n
dre
Bique
ready t
o
test
more expr
commit
|
commitdiff
|
tree
2009-03-05
Alexa
n
dre Bique
ad
d
ed n
e
w expr to
test
commit
|
commitdiff
|
tree
2009-03-05
Alexan
d
re
B
ique
next st
e
p
is to enchance
g
en
.
py to
ha
v
e
m
ore expr t
o
.
.
.
commit
|
commitdiff
|
tree
2009-03-05
Alexandre Bique
made the cast float->bool
throw
an error
commit
|
commitdiff
|
tree
2009-03-04
A
l
exandre Bique
fixed
cmp expressions
commit
|
commitdiff
|
tree
2009-03-04
Alexandre Bi
q
ue
mov
e
d
bad expr
to
b
ad_expr folder
commit
|
commitdiff
|
tree
2009-03-04
Alexandre
Bique
a
dded some text t
o
readme
commit
|
commitdiff
|
tree
2009-03-04
A
l
e
x
andre Bique
should
f
i
x
cmp expression for floats but i
s
h
ould ha
v
e
.
.
.
commit
|
commitdiff
|
tree
2009-03-04
A
lexandre
B
ique
moved b
a
d expressi
o
n to a new folde
r
commit
|
commitdiff
|
tree
2009-03-04
Alexandre
B
ique
forgot to t
y
pe bitwise exp
r
ession
commit
|
commitdiff
|
tree
2009-03-04
Alexandre Bique
using a new macro
t
o type chec
k
bitwise expres
s
i
on
commit
|
commitdiff
|
tree
2009-03-04
Alexandre
Bique
s
etting the output
c
olor to normal
commit
|
commitdiff
|
tree
2009-03-04
Alex
a
ndre Bique
check_expr
.
sh: piping to less and no
t
stopping a
t
the
.
.
.
commit
|
commitdiff
|
tree
2009-03-04
Alexandre Bique
typo
commit
|
commitdiff
|
tree
2009-03-04
Ale
x
a
n
dre Bique
using my new
g
eneric multi-method
commit
|
commitdiff
|
tree
2009-03-03
Alexand
r
e Biq
u
e
r
en
a
me
d
m
ulti
m
ethod to m
u
lti-method
commit
|
commitdiff
|
tree
2009-03-03
Alexa
n
dr
e
Bique
ad
d
ed generi
c
m
u
l
t
imethod implementation
commit
|
commitdiff
|
tree
2009-03-03
Alexandre Bi
q
ue
simpli
f
ied some macro
usage, a
n
d adde
d
c
a
st int ->
.
.
.
commit
|
commitdiff
|
tree
2009-03-03
Alexandre
B
ique
cast fro
m
f
l
oat to in
t
i
s
rea
l
shit
commit
|
commitdiff
|
tree
2009-03-03
Alexandre Bique
assert false is better
than no
t
compiling
commit
|
commitdiff
|
tree
2009-03-03
Alexandre Bique
hehe i kno
w
this one breaks compilation but i'
l
l
know
.
.
.
commit
|
commitdiff
|
tree
2009-03-03
Alexandre Bique
so
m
e work o
n
or
o
r an
d
andand
commit
|
commitdiff
|
tree
2009-03-03
Alexandre Bique
f
ix th
e
type
o
f
co
m
pa
r
aison to bool
commit
|
commitdiff
|
tree
2009-03-03
A
lexan
d
re
Bique
t
e
sts-clean
commit
|
commitdiff
|
tree
2009-03-02
Alexandre Bique
ad
d
ed new tests
:-)
commit
|
commitdiff
|
tree
2009-03-01
Alexandre Bique
pass all expr tests
commit
|
commitdiff
|
tree
2009-03-01
A
lexandre Biqu
e
note
commit
|
commitdiff
|
tree
2009-03-01
Alexandre Bi
q
ue
cast i
n
teg
e
r -> floa
t
commit
|
commitdiff
|
tree
2009-03-01
A
l
exandre Bique
cast d
o
u
ble -
>
double
commit
|
commitdiff
|
tree
2009-03-01
A
l
exan
d
re B
i
que
cast bool -
>
integer
commit
|
commitdiff
|
tree
2009-03-01
Alexandre Bique
cas
t
bool -> floa
t
commit
|
commitdiff
|
tree
2009-03-01
Alexandre Bique
s
o
me code f
a
ctori
s
a
t
i
o
n
commit
|
commitdiff
|
tree
2009-03-01
A
lex
a
ndre Bique
some
c
asting
s
upport
commit
|
commitdiff
|
tree
2009-03-01
Al
e
xandre Bique
mo
r
e s
u
pport for casting n
u
m
bers
commit
|
commitdiff
|
tree
2009-03-01
Alexandre Bique
fixe
d
cast
bool, bool
commit
|
commitdiff
|
tree
2009-03-01
Alexandre Biq
u
e
a
d
ded
a
note
commit
|
commitdiff
|
tree
2009-03-01
Alexand
r
e Bi
q
u
e
blah
commit
|
commitdiff
|
tree
2009-03-01
Al
e
xandre
B
i
qu
e
b
e
t
t
er clean
commit
|
commitdiff
|
tree
2009-03-01
Alex
a
ndre Bi
q
ue
trailing
whit
e
spac
e
s
commit
|
commitdiff
|
tree
2009-03-01
Ale
x
and
r
e Bique
generating native
executable
commit
|
commitdiff
|
tree
next